*Intel® Optane™ memory (cache) is sold separately. Intel® Optane™ memory system acceleration does
not replace or increase the DRAM in your system. Available for HP commercial desktops and
notebooks and for select HP workstations (Z2 Tower/SFF/Mini G4, ZBook Studio, 15 and 17 G5) and
requires a SATA HDD, 7th Gen or higher Intel® Core™ processor or Intel® Xeon® processor E3-1200 V6
product family or higher, BIOS version with Intel® Optane™ supported, Windows 10 version 1703 or
higher, M.2 type 2280-S1-B-M connector on a PCH Remapped PCIe Controller and Lanes in a x2 or x4
configuration with B-M keys that meet NVMe™ Spec 1.1, and an Intel® Rapid Storage Technology
Intel® RST 16.5 driver.

NOTE 1: For storage drives, GB = 1 billion bytes. TB = 1 trillion bytes. Actual formatted capacity is less.
Up to 36GB (for Windows 10) of system disk is reserved for system recovery software.
NOTE 2: The HP Z2G4 TWR is capable of configuring up to 2 Z Turbo Drives. By default, the Z Turbo
Drive configured will be installed in the M.2 storage slots on the system’s motherboard.
